Fine Art + Design Selections

The February Fine Art + Design Selections sale consists of Post War and Contemporary Art, Prints and Design at attractive price points. This curated auction includes works by Nicholas Carone, Sol LeWitt, Richard Anuszkiewicz, and Gene Davis. Design selections from Hendrick Van Keppel & Taylor Green, Eero Saarinen, and Edward Wormley will be offered, in addition to an assortment of Mid 20th Century Property from the Estate of Louise Hart, Glencoe, Illinois.
